SILENT WORLD - BBC X LOWKEY FILMS
EXEC PRODUCER.
In a dystopian future where a deadly gas forces humanity underground, Silent World follows SignKid, a Deaf rapper, as he navigates a world that has become increasingly inaccessible. The film explores the heightened isolation and societal disconnection experienced by the Deaf community during the COVID-19 pandemic, reflecting on the everyday challenges faced by those without access to vital information. Through a fusion of music and visual storytelling, Silent Worldamplifies the voices of the D/deaf community, offering a poignant commentary on communication, resilience, and the human spirit.

BOARDERS
PRODUCER.
The past and present collide when a man steps into a social club, soon becoming clear that his motive is linked to his teen years, and the events that traumatised him.
Initially there is a distinct emphasis on the teenager, and a complicated co-dependent relationship with the boy who holds sway over him. As events come to a head, in both flashback and 'present-day'.
The inevitable confrontation with the man’s old adversary - now apparently normal stand-up guy, still with the same girl - delivers its own unexpected twist. A really strong way to show the lasting damage created by a poisoned youth.
Starring: Ryan Nolan (1917, How to build a girl)
